    Russian super featherweight champion Evgueny “Happy Gilmore” Chuprakov (13-0, 7 KOs), a sneaky, well-rounded boxer from Ekaterinburg, Russia, managed by Vadim Kornilov, will go for his first international title on September 26 in his hometown at the Arena.

    The card will be promoted by German Titov, and his son Alexey Titov will act as a matchmaker.

    The vacant WBO European 130-pound title will be up for grabs, and Chuprakov’s opponent will be a tough one – the former IBF super flyweight champion Dmitry “Baby” Kirillov (31-6-1, 10 KOs). Kirillov, 36, is very much down the hill but still can be a better test for Chuprakov than any of his recent opponents. Chuprakov hasn’t been seen against a tough foe arguably since his win over Alexey Shorokov in November 2013.
